In such a survival game, where everyone can do whatever he likes to do, the very best method is to be careful and don't let you be seen if you know there are players around. If they've seen you, you're a prey. Best thing is to send a message if anyone is around the location if you don't want to travel alone. If nobody answers, you should be very careful and ready your weapon. It doesn't mean that you should shoot everyone you see in that case, it means to be ready for conflict. If somebody answers to your message, it doesn't mean he's your friend. Quite the opposite, he can take you into a trap. Mostly, if people are in danger like a dozen of zombies are following them, they're likely to answer in chat or to accept your help. Don't even try to make such movements like salute or lower your weapon. Think about someone low on food or water or whatever for a reason he needs to kill you. He simply profits for that occasion. Another point of view : A survivor is now alive for about 15 game hours. He has the very best equipment you can get. He has 2 options : 1.- He will continue to have fun at surviving but is EXTREMELY careful about enemy contact. He'll be likely to shoot you since he's scared to loose all his hard earned equipment. 2.- He's getting bored. That's the most dangerous moment ... Something personal (My point of view) : I'm not a bandit nor i'm a griefer nor racist ... But, if it happens that you encounter someone that isn't willing to cooperate with you and you're not sure about his actions, it is recommanded to either shoot him or ignore him by avoiding sight contact. Same goes for people who are not talking your language which guides to impossibility to communicate with each other. He isn't useful for you nor are you for him. If you're in a bad situation like being short on supplies, being not sure about his next actions, you should better kill him in some situations. But again that's my opinion :D
